Drain cleaner Safety Warnings
1. Maintain labels and nameplates on the tool.
These carry important safety information.
If unreadable or missing, contact
Harbor Freight Tools for a replacement.
2. To reduce the risk of electrical shock, do not
put motor or battery in water or other liquid.
3. Do not wear cloth gloves or loose clothing, or use
a rag to grasp the cable to prevent entanglement.
4. Use appropriate personal protective equipment
while handling and using Drain Cleaner. Drains may
contain chemicals, bacteria and other substances
that may be toxic, infectious, cause burns or other
issues. Appropriate personal protective equipment
always includes ANSI-approved splash-resistant
safety glasses under face shield, NIOSH-approved
dust mask/respirator, and heavy-duty LEATHER
work gloves, and may include equipment such
as latex or rubber gloves under LEATHER work
gloves, protective clothing, and steel toed footwear.
5. Do not use in pipe containing
drain cleaning chemicals.
6. Do not use in pipe obstructed by roots.
7. Wash hands after use. Use hot, soapy water
to wash hands and other exposed body parts
exposed to drain contents after handling or using
Drain Cleaner. Do not eat or smoke while operating
or handling Drain Cleaner. This will help prevent
contamination with toxic or infectious material.
8. Have your Drain Cleaner serviced by a qualified
repair person using only identical replacement parts.
This will ensure that the safety of the
Drain Cleaner is maintained.
9. Do not put too much stress on Cable.
Quickly release tension if it starts to build
in the cable. Excess tension will cause
the Cable to twist, kink, or break.
10. Reverse Motor direction only when pulling the
Cable off an obstruction. Trying to push the
Cable down the pipe or pull it out of a pipe while
in reverse operation will unravel and break
the Cable. Wait for the Drum to stop turning
completely before changing the Rotation Switch.
11. Only use Drain Cleaner to clean drains of
recommended sizes according to these instructions.
Other uses or modifying the Drain Cleaner for
other applications may increase the risk of injury.

13. Avoid unintentional starting.
Prepare to begin work before turning on the tool.
14. Do not lay the tool down until it has come to
a complete stop. Moving parts can grab the
surface and pull the tool out of your control.
15. When using a handheld power tool,
maintain a firm grip on the tool with both
hands to resist starting torque.
16. Do not leave the tool unattended when it is
plugged into an electrical outlet the Battery
Pack is connected. Turn off the tool, and
unplug it from its electrical outlet remove
the Battery Pack before leaving.
17.
The battery Charger gets hot during use.
The Charger's heat can build up to
unsafe levels and create a fire
hazard if it does not receive
adequate ventilation, due to an electrical fault, or if it
is used in a hot environment.
Do not place the Charger on a flammable surface.
Do not obstruct any vents on the Charger.
Especially avoid placing the charger on carpets
and rugs; they are not only flammable, but they
also obstruct vents under the charger.
Place the Charger on a stable, solid, nonflammable
surface (such as a stable metal workbench or
concrete floor) at least 1 foot away from all
flammable objects, such as drapes or walls. Keep a
fire extinguisher and a smoke detector in the area.
Frequently monitor the Charger and
Battery Pack while charging.
18. This product is not a toy.
Keep it out of reach of children.
19. People with pacemakers should consult their
physician(s) before use. Electromagnetic fields in
close proximity to heart pacemaker could cause
pacemaker interference or pacemaker failure.
In addition, people with pacemakers should:
• Avoid operating alone.
• Do not use with Trigger locked on.
• Properly maintain and inspect
to avoid electrical shock.
